Richard Schiffman: The Most Anti-Environment Congress in History: Here's the Record

huffingtonpost.com (10 months and 28 days ago)

Jun 21, 2012

Everyone knows that we are facing an unprecedented environmental crisis, right? Wrong. This news seems never to have gotten through to America's Republican legislators. The GOP majority over the last year has voted no fewer than 247 times to weaken environmental protections. full story
